No properties available at the moment.

No properties available at the moment.

Testimonials

Office space in Office Space In N19

Office space in N19

Nestled at the heart of North London, N19 is a vibrant community that bridges the charm of historical London with the pulse of modern life. Known for its distinctive atmosphere, this area offers a rich tapestry of cultural landmarks, eclectic eateries, and lush green spaces, making it a captivating locale for businesses looking to thrive in a dynamic environment. With excellent transport links, including the Archway tube station on the Northern Line, this area promises connectivity across London, ensuring ease of access for both clients and employees. Whether you’re an established enterprise or a burgeoning start-up, N19 offers a diverse range of office spaces designed to foster creativity, collaboration, and growth. Join the ranks of forward-thinking businesses in a location that blends the best of London’s heritage with its future.

Get in touch

Fill in your contact details below and we'll put you in touch with one of our representatives

Free Expert Guidance

Tailored Quick Quotes

Flexible Viewings

Guaranteed Best Deals

Rated 5.0

Google

Popular Locations